Obituary for Carol M. A. Jaccodine (Coyle)

Print
HARDYSTON –Carol Jaccodine (nee Coyle) passed away on Tuesday, 10/3/2018 at Morristown Memorial Center, after a short illness. Her husband, Tom, was by her side. Born in Weehawken, NJ on Dec. 12, 1945, Carol resided in Hardyston for the past 45 years.

Carol received both her B.A. and M.A. from Montclair State College (now university). Upon graduation, Carol worked as a speech teacher in a variety of elementary and high schools, serving the majority of her teaching career at the Hamburg School in Hamburg, NJ. After retiring, Carol continued to work as a Speech Teacher at Willowglen Academy for a few additional years. Combing her love of working with senior citizens and children, Carol served as the pen pal coordinator of Earth Angels for the last three years.

Carol was a loving wife, mother, grandmother, and friend. She is known for her candor, her strength, and her desire to genuinely help others. She genuinely loved to teach and to help her students communicate their thoughts and feelings more effectively. Her love of travel led to her working as a part time outside sales travel agent at AAA for several years while employed as a teacher. Although she traveled with her family throughout the United States, her favorite place to be was Schoodic Point in Acadia National Park, Maine. Carol also enjoyed going the theatre, the movies, and cooking. Most of all, she loved spending time with and supporting her children and grandchildren.

Carol was predeceased by her parents Howard Coyle and Catherine (La Sasso). She is survived by her husband of over 50 years, Thomas, of Hardyston, her daughters, Michelle Jordan and her husband, Ben, of Windham, Maine, grandsons, Elliot and Nathan Jordan and Kristen Jaccodine of Hardyston, by her sister Diane Marzocchi, her nephew Brent; and by a special family friend, Pam Olysn of Byram. She is also survived by her sister in law Dianne and her husband Dr. Raymond Monico of Succasunna and their children Jason and his wife Liz, Jeffrey, and Jessica and her husband Justin.

Friends and Family are invited to a Mass of Christian Burial will be held at St. Jude the Apostle R.C. Church in Hamburg on Saturday, Oct. 6th at 9:30AM. Interment will be private.

Funeral arrangements and care were entrusted by F. John Ramsey Funeral Home, One Main St., Franklin, NJ. Donations may be made to the American Cancer Society. Condolences may be sent directly to the family.
